Transaction 283a754bea412a1302812066982db6186ae57821067ff232247614ca00a9f808

1 Input
2 Outputs
  • 283a754bea412a1302812066982db6186ae57821067ff232247614ca00a9f808:0
  • value  325523
    address  1MMnkkLbAk2fhzpqgFCCLMwBgcFATK6hnR
  • 283a754bea412a1302812066982db6186ae57821067ff232247614ca00a9f808:1
  • value  5384858
    address  153CQPtvDPkqNEQsoHVLvEWwgk6jbYK8Es